I've been on the Explorer 4 or 5 trips, and on a couple on Mike's previous boat the Nautilus VII, and I can unequivocally say that I've never seen any "raping and pillaging." Mike, in fact, occasionally dives with the group and gets quite upset if there is *any* damage to walls (even finger-touching to push off a wall in current). I've been with operators and on live-aboards all over the world, and I know of no one better than Mike's operation at ecological awareness and a strict no-take/no-harm policy... --Ken

Mike makes his living taking divers to look at marine life. If he allowed his guests and crew to destroy it, he's out of business because people will stop coming. No, I think you need to look more closely at those that would profit from it.
 
I have also done a Nautilus trip, and apart from a misunderstanding regarding me wanting to dive Nitrox, it was a great trip. No one took anything while on a dive. I know he does allow fishing, but from the surface with a rod and tackle. I'd definitely go with them again.
